# Chalk Butte Formation

The **Chalk Butte Formation** is a [geologic formation](/source/Formation_(geology)) in [Oregon](/source/Oregon), which forms a part of the Idaho Group.[1] It preserves [fossils](/source/Fossils) dating back to the [Neogene](/source/Neogene) [period](/source/Period_(geology)).[2] It was proposed along with the Grassy Mountain Basalt Formation and the Kern Basin Formation as a division of the Idaho Group rocks in the Mitchell Butte Quadrangle.[3] The predominant rock types are [tuffaceous](/source/Tuffaceous) [sandstones](/source/Sandstone), [siltstones](/source/Siltstone), and [conglomerates](/source/Conglomerate_(geology)) with smaller amounts of tuff, ash beds, and freshwater [limestone](/source/Limestone).[3] A partial section at the type location determined the formation to be about 538 feet thick.[3]

## Fossil content

The following fossils have been reported from the formation:[2][4]

- *[Antecalomys valensis](/source/Antecalomys)*
- *[Basirepomys pliocenicus](/source/Basirepomys)*
- *[Copemys cf. esmeraldensis](/source/Copemys)*
- *[Cupidinimus magnus](/source/Cupidinimus)*
- *[Diprionomys parvus](/source/Diprionomys)*
- *[Dipoides vallicula](/source/Dipoides)*
- *[Eucyon davisi](/source/Eucyon)*
- *[Goniodontomys disjunctus](/source/Goniodontomys)*
- *[Hypolagus vetus](/source/Hypolagus)*
- *[Peromyscus antiquus](/source/Peromyscus)*
- *[Pliohippus spectans](/source/Pliohippus)*
- *[Plionictis oregonensis](/source/Plionictis)*
- *[Scapanus proceridens](/source/Scapanus)*
- *[Dipoides sp.](/source/Dipoides)*
- *[Spermophilus sp.](/source/Spermophilus)*
- [Camelidae indet.](/source/Camelidae)
- [Perognathinae indet.](/source/Perognathinae)
- [Soricidae indet.](/source/Soricidae)
- [?Vespertilionidae indet.](/source/Vespertilionidae)
